Angelyn Chandler
Angelyn Chandler is an architect and the vice president–planning at the New York Power Authority, where she leads the Reimagine the Canals initiative to catalyze economic development across upstate New York.
She has extensive experience in park development and urban design, most recently as a vice president in the Capital division at the New York City Economic Development Corporation, with a project portfolio focused on waterfront resilience, and as deputy commissioner for Capital Programs at the New York State Office of Parks, Recreation and Historic Preservation. Earlier she was a capital program director for NYC Parks, and led the Community Parks Initiative, the reconstruction of NYC’s beaches following Superstorm Sandy, the development of Freshkills Park, and the construction of the High Line Headquarters.
Chandler received her undergraduate degree in Architecture from Washington University in St. Louis and her Master of Architecture from Princeton University.
